dpfe hoses why am i blowing them off when they should be sucking
 
i have and 03 lightning and when i gas on it i blow the hoses to the dpfe sensor off why is there presure blowing them off when they should be making a vacuum?

Ford_Six 06-04-2012 09:37 PM

The cats may be plugging up or there's another restriction in the exhaust system.

Papa Tiger 06-06-2012 10:36 PM

Mufflers often rust internally and restrict the gas flow, especially if OEM. If original equipment, I wouldn't over thinkit, simply sawzall muffler/catz at a time off.
